Description

Benzonitrile, 3-(Aminomethyl)-5-(Trifluoromethyl)- (9Ci) is a high-value, multifunctional aromatic nitrile building block distinguished by its trifluoromethyl and aminomethyl substituents. This compound matters for its role in facilitating the synthesis of complex molecules, particularly in advanced pharmaceutical and agrochemical research where the introduction of fluorine atoms is critical for modulating bioactivity and metabolic stability. It is primarily needed by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and specialty chemical industries for creating novel active ingredients and functional materials.

Basic Information

Product Name Benzonitrile, 3-(Aminomethyl)-5-(Trifluoromethyl)- (9Ci)
CAS No. 693250-09-8
Molecular Formula C9H7F3N2
Molecular Weight 200.16 g/mol
Synonyms 3-(Aminomethyl)-5-(trifluoromethyl)benzonitrile; 5-(Trifluoromethyl)-3-cyanobenzylamine; [3-(Aminomethyl)-5-(trifluoromethyl)phenyl]methanamine; 3-Cyano-5-(trifluoromethyl)benzylamine; α-Amino-m-(trifluoromethyl)benzonitrile; 3-(Trifluoromethyl)-5-cyanobenzylamine; (3-Cyano-5-(trifluoromethyl)phenyl)methanamine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). This compound is hygroscopic (moisture-sensitive); keep the container tightly sealed under an inert atmosphere such as nitrogen or argon to prevent degradation. Keep away from strong acids and strong oxidizing agents.
